Thanet & East Kent Chess League
The League organises and promotes the playing of chess in Thanet and in East Kent, and it runs competitions for all levels of playing strength. For the latest standings in these competitions, click here to visit the League page on the ECF League Management System.

The annual Thanet Chess Congress, incorporating the Kent Individual Championships, is held in August.
The League is a member of the SCCU (Southern Counties Chess Union).
